1. travel essay; travel writing; literary travelogue
A literary genre of polished writing about travel experiences, emphasizing observation, reflection, and prose quality rather than simple record-keeping.

A compound of 紀行(きこう) (travel record) and (ぶん) (writing/essay). A literary genre with a long tradition in Japanese literature, from classical works like (おく)細道(ほそみち) by 松尾(まつお)芭蕉(ばしょう) to modern travel essays.

Common collocations

  • 紀行文(きこうぶん)(): to write a travel essay
  • 紀行文(きこうぶん)(しゅう): collection of travel essays
  • 紀行文(きこうぶん)(がく): the study of travel writing
